Define Archiving Goals and Requirements: Clearly outline the objectives of your data archiving strategy. Determine what types of data need to be archived and for how long. Identify legal and regulatory requirements that govern data retention in your industry. Consider the specific needs of your organization, such as compliance, business continuity, or historical analysis.
